We are seeking a Payroll Accountant Senior to ensure the accurate and timely processing of payroll for nearly 1,600 salaried and hourly employees across six agencies (DSAs) while adhering to established federal and state policies, procedures, and regulations.
- This role involves reconciling complex payroll and deduction registers with the corresponding payment and deduction documentation.
- Additionally, the position is responsible for health care reconciliations, managing garnishments, adjusting payroll transactions, and handling tax liens.
- The Payroll Accountant collaborates with all units within the Finance Division and Human Resources on payroll transactions.
- This position requires maintaining confidentiality while addressing payroll inquiries from employees and providing exceptional customer service.

Minimum Qualifications:
The ideal candidate will have:
Knowledge/Experience:
- Training in or applied work experience in payroll accounting in a large public agency environment.
Abilities/Skills:
- Demonstrated ability in all payroll-related areas, including but not limited to healthcare/benefits, special payrolls, garnishments, vouchers related to payroll/suspense account activity, retirement/VNAV/VRS requirements, and taxes.
- Demonstrated ability to handle multiple functions, to analyze/interpret and apply financial regulations, accounting methods, policies, and procedures; to meet deadlines; to analyze and solve complex problems; to prepare complex spreadsheets, financial reports, and statements; and to work in an automated environment.
- Ability to interpret and implement federal and state employment laws, policies, and regulations related to salaried and wage employee pay.
- Interpersonal and communication skills and the ability to work effectively and exercise a high degree of diplomacy, discretion, and collaboration in dealing with a variety of stakeholders at all levels.
- Skilled in the use of Oracle (or similar financial software database).
- Microsoft 365 - Proficient with Excel (pivot tables, vlookups, macros, etc.) for efficiency in extracting data, data manipulation, and analyzing data.
- Ability to provide sound guidance and direction to agency leadership.
- Ability to assist agency personnel in the resolution of payroll-related questions.
- Extreme attention to detail and data entry accuracy
